285.64 285.64(1) (1) Issuance to sources not in compliance; federal objection. 285.64(1)(a) (a) Notwithstanding s. 285.63 , the department may issue an operation permit for a stationary source that does not comply with the requirements in the operation permit, in the federal clean air act, in an implementation plan under s. 285.11 (6) or in s. 285.63 when the operation permit is issued if the operation permit includes all of the following: 285.64(1)(a)1.

1.A compliance schedule that sets forth a series of remedial measures that the owner or operator of the stationary source must take to comply with the requirements with which the stationary source is in violation when the operation permit is issued. 285.64(1)(a)2.
